学位论文 > 优秀研究生学位论文题录展示

面向体系结构的软件安全性需求开发方法研究

作 者: 姜超
导 师: 张彩虹
学 校: 长春理工大学
专 业: 计算机软件与理论
关键词: 软件安全性 安全性需求 软件体系结构 软件工程 安全工程
分类号: TP311.52
类 型: 硕士论文
年 份: 2011年
下 载: 39次
引 用: 0次
阅 读: 论文下载
 

内容摘要


随着软件在安全性关键系统中的应用规模越来越大、承担的安全性关键指挥控制功能越来越多,安全性关键的软件密集型系统(SCSIS)已初露端倪。在SCSIS中,软件安全性需求被认为是决定系统安全性的一个主要因素。本文旨在研究体系结构设计阶段的软件安全性需求开发技术,这是因为:一方面软件体系结构表征了基本的安全性策略,另一方面确保体系结构全面、客观地反映软件安全性需求,将能避免后期返工。本文主要工作和贡献体现在:(1)综述了软件安全性研究现状。剖析了安全性与系统、软件的关系,明确了软件安全性的研究内容、工程过程;讨论了典型的软件安全性需求开发与表示方法,获得了在体系结构设计阶段开发软件安全性需求的重要启示;(2)提出了一种基于目标和场景的软件安全性需求开发方法。该方法要求软件安全性需求开发与体系结构设计协同进行。通过对分配在体系结构上的目标及实现场景进行背离分析,开发出相应的反目标及负面场景。然后针对风险不可接受的负面场景,开发出包含危险处置策略及度量标准的软件安全性需求,求精软件体系结构设计。以一个汽车电传制动系统为例说明了该方法的应用可行性。

全文目录


摘要  4-5
ABSTRACT  5-6
目录  6-8
第一章 绪论  8-13
  1.1 研究背景  8-9
  1.2 研究现状  9-10
  1.3 本文工作  10-11
  1.4 组织结构  11-13
第二章 软件安全性综述  13-28
  2.1 安全性与系统  13-15
  2.2 安全性与软件  15-24
  2.3 安全性基本理论  24-27
  2.4 本章小结  27-28
第三章 软件安全性需求开发与表示方法  28-41
  3.1 需求与安全性需求  28-31
  3.2 软件安全性需求开发方法  31-35
  3.3 软件安全性需求表示方法  35-39
  3.4 启示  39-40
  3.5 本章小结  40-41
第四章 目标和场景相结合的软件安全性需求开发方法  41-53
  4.1 安全性与体系结构  41
  4.2 安全性的横切特征  41-42
  4.3 基于目标和场景的构件交互模型  42-46
  4.4 目标和场景相结合的软件安全性需求开发过程  46-51
  4.5 相关研究  51
  4.6 本章小结  51-53
第五章 案例研究  53-63
  5.1 汽车电传制动系统  53-54
  5.2 目标与反目标开发  54-55
  5.3 目标UCM场景实现  55-56
  5.4 负面场景开发  56-60
  5.5 安全性需求开发  60-62
  5.6 本章小结  62-63
第六章 总结与展望  63-65
  6.1 工作和成果  63
  6.2 研究展望  63-65
致谢  65-66
参考文献  66-69

相似论文

  1. 宜宾移动IT支撑系统设计研究,TP311.52
  2. 盘锦市区划地名信息系统的设计与实现,TP311.52
  3. 伺服压力机上位机控制及工艺规划软件的研究,TP273
  4. 基于混合软件体系结构模型的电厂SIS,TP311.52
  5. 软件体系结构自适应模型及其智能化研究,TP311.52
  6. 基于知识发现的职业技术教育管理系统设计与实现,TP311.52
  7. 基于进程代数的面向服务软件体系结构建模,TP393.09
  8. 基于SOA的企业OA系统的研究,TP317.1
  9. 数据挖掘技术在软件知识库中的应用研究,TP311.13
  10. 面向科技计划项目管理领域的框架研究与设计,TP311.52
  11. 基于构件的软件产品线技术研究,TP311.52
  12. 基于B/S架构的校园网信息系统的设计与实现,TP311.52
  13. 药品集中采购系统的设计与实现,TP311.52
  14. 贵州空管防雷业务集约化平台研究与实现,TP311.52
  15. 四川建筑学院学生管理系统的开发与实现,TP311.52
  16. 包头财经学校学生信息管理系统的设计与实现,TP311.52
  17. 基于遗传算法的浙江水利水电专科学校排课系统设计与实现,TP311.52
  18. 滨海开发区信访管理系统的设计与实现,TP311.52
  19. 基于B/S模式的独立学院学籍管理信息系统设计与开发,TP311.52
  20. 高校后勤信息化管理系统的设计与开发,TP311.52

中图分类: > 工业技术 > 自动化技术、计算机技术 > 计算技术、计算机技术 > 计算机软件 > 程序设计、软件工程 > 软件工程 > 软件开发
© 2012 www.xueweilunwen.com